Corporate Grade: Analyst Business Area: Barclays International - Corporate & Investment BankingDepartment/Function Level: BankingPrimary Location: StockholmIAR Role: No About Nordic BankingBarclays Nordic Banking team is a corporate finance team involved in the origination and execution of transactions with corporates and financial sponsors in the Nordic region. As primary relationship holders, the team have dialogue with clients across the full range of products offered by Barclays (including M&A, DCM, ECM, Risk Management and Credit Ratings). The team is currently made up of 10 people (co-located across London and Stockholm) and is looking to further invest to both help to execute the existing pipeline of transactions and assist in expanding the origination efforts.Dynamic working gives everyone at Barclays the opportunity to integrate professional and personal lives, if you have a need for flexibility then please discuss this with the hiring manager. We are an equal opportunity employer and we are opposed to discrimination on any grounds.Overall purpose of roleThe successful candidate will be responsible for supporting senior team members with the origination and execution of advisory and financing transactions for Nordic clients across all industry sectors and the full investment bank product suite (M&A, DCM, ECM, Risk Management and Ratings). The candidate will be expected to build relationships with external clients and relevant internal sector and product groups.
